<i>Mastering Algorithms with Perl</i> does indeed rock the Free World.
<p>
I took Computer Science several years ago, and it's really nice to have a single book explaining to me all the stuff that I've managed to forget. Parsing. Graph Theory. Number theory. Compression. With Examples. In perl.
<p>
I think that the only (<b>only!</b>) weakness of this book is that some areas are treated rather superficially (I'd really liked to learn more about bottom-up parsing for example). But there are a lot of references to other material, so you can easily look it up if you're eager.
<p>
The book also lists standard CPAN modules implementing functionality presented in each chapter, so you don't have to reinvent the wheel every time. Unless you want to, of course.
